From d0b540df6740fcffd9de92b5d2fe0a2bf91a0022 Mon Sep 17 00:00:00 2001 From: Remy Prechelt <prechelt@hawaii.edu> Date: Tue, 14 Jul 2020 10:30:39 -1000 Subject: [PATCH] Rename UrQMD random number stream (from UrQMD to urqmd). --- Documentation/Examples/vertical_EAS.cc | 2 +- Processes/UrQMD/UrQMD.cc | 2 +- Processes/UrQMD/UrQMD.h | 3 ++- Processes/UrQMD/testUrQMD.cc | 2 +- 4 files changed, 5 insertions(+), 4 deletions(-) diff --git a/Documentation/Examples/vertical_EAS.cc b/Documentation/Examples/vertical_EAS.cc index 7b9e996cf..a1f39a925 100644 --- a/Documentation/Examples/vertical_EAS.cc +++ b/Documentation/Examples/vertical_EAS.cc @@ -59,7 +59,7 @@ void registerRandomStreams() { random::RNGManager::GetInstance().RegisterRandomStream("qgran"); random::RNGManager::GetInstance().RegisterRandomStream("sibyll"); random::RNGManager::GetInstance().RegisterRandomStream("pythia"); - random::RNGManager::GetInstance().RegisterRandomStream("UrQMD"); + random::RNGManager::GetInstance().RegisterRandomStream("urqmd"); random::RNGManager::GetInstance().SeedAll(); } diff --git a/Processes/UrQMD/UrQMD.cc b/Processes/UrQMD/UrQMD.cc index a9ee78c11..cc9e02f61 100644 --- a/Processes/UrQMD/UrQMD.cc +++ b/Processes/UrQMD/UrQMD.cc @@ -358,7 +358,7 @@ corsika::process::EProcessReturn UrQMD::DoInteraction(SetupProjectile& projectil */ double corsika::process::UrQMD::ranf_(int&) { static corsika::random::RNG& rng = - corsika::random::RNGManager::GetInstance().GetRandomStream("UrQMD"); + corsika::random::RNGManager::GetInstance().GetRandomStream("urqmd"); static std::uniform_real_distribution<double> dist; return dist(rng); diff --git a/Processes/UrQMD/UrQMD.h b/Processes/UrQMD/UrQMD.h index 1852e3d2e..7ef119eb9 100644 --- a/Processes/UrQMD/UrQMD.h +++ b/Processes/UrQMD/UrQMD.h @@ -46,10 +46,11 @@ namespace corsika::process::UrQMD { bool CanInteract(particles::Code) const; private: + void readXSFile(std::string const&); corsika::random::RNG& rng_ = - corsika::random::RNGManager::GetInstance().GetRandomStream("UrQMD"); + corsika::random::RNGManager::GetInstance().GetRandomStream("urqmd"); std::uniform_int_distribution<int> booleanDist_{0, 1}; boost::multi_array<corsika::units::si::CrossSectionType, 3> xs_interp_support_table_; diff --git a/Processes/UrQMD/testUrQMD.cc b/Processes/UrQMD/testUrQMD.cc index 5690e0c28..fd947e83f 100644 --- a/Processes/UrQMD/testUrQMD.cc +++ b/Processes/UrQMD/testUrQMD.cc @@ -130,7 +130,7 @@ TEST_CASE("UrQMD") { } feenableexcept(FE_INVALID); - corsika::random::RNGManager::GetInstance().RegisterRandomStream("UrQMD"); + corsika::random::RNGManager::GetInstance().RegisterRandomStream("urqmd"); UrQMD urqmd; SECTION("interaction length") { -- GitLab